Inflammatory diseases, such as arthritis, asthma, and inflammatory bowel disease, can significantly impact an individual's quality of life. While conventional treatments are available, some individuals may seek natural alternatives to complement their traditional therapies. Here are several natural supplements that are commonly used to help manage inflammatory diseases:

 

1. Omega-3 Fatty Acids - Found in fish oil, flaxseeds, and walnuts, omega-3 fatty acids have potent anti-inflammatory properties. Studies have shown that supplementation with omega-3 fatty acids can help reduce inflammation and alleviate symptoms in conditions like rheumatoid arthritis and inflammatory bowel disease.

 

2. Curcumin - Derived from the spice turmeric, curcumin has long been used in traditional medicine for its anti-inflammatory properties. It helps inhibit the activity of certain molecules involved in inflammation, making it useful for conditions like osteoarthritis and inflammatory bowel disease.

 

3. Green Tea - Green tea contains a catechin called epigallocatechin-3-gallate (EGCG), which has been shown to possess anti-inflammatory properties. Regular consumption of green tea may help reduce inflammation in the body and provide relief for conditions like rheumatoid arthritis and asthma.

 

4. Ginger - Ginger has been used for centuries as a natural remedy for various ailments, including inflammation. It contains gingerols and shogaols, which have been found to have anti-inflammatory effects. Incorporating ginger into your diet or taking ginger supplements can help reduce inflammation and relieve symptoms associated with inflammatory diseases.

 

5. Boswellia - Also known as Indian frankincense, Boswellia extract has been traditionally used to manage inflammation. It contains active compounds called boswellic acids that can help inhibit inflammatory enzymes. Boswellia supplements are commonly used to alleviate symptoms of conditions like osteoarthritis and asthma.

 

6. Bromelain - Derived from pineapples, bromelain is a mixture of enzymes that exhibit anti-inflammatory properties. It can help reduce swelling and inflammation associated with conditions like arthritis and sinusitis. Bromelain supplements are available in capsule form.

 

7. Resveratrol - Found in grapes, berries, and red wine, resveratrol is a polyphenol known for its anti-inflammatory and antioxidant properties. It can help suppress inflammation and protect against chronic diseases. However, moderation is key when consuming alcohol, and it's important to consult a healthcare professional before using resveratrol supplements.

 

8. Glucosamine - Glucosamine has been found to modulate the immune response, particularly by regulating the production of inflammatory cytokines. Inflammatory diseases result from an imbalance in the immune system, where it becomes overly active and attacks healthy tissues. Glucosamine can help restore this balance and reduce the autoimmune response, thus providing benefits for inflammatory diseases.

 

9. Chondroitin -Chondroitin has been found to possess anti-inflammatory properties, which can help alleviate symptoms associated with inflammatory diseases. It works by inhibiting the activity of certain enzymes that cause inflammation and reducing the production of inflammatory molecules. It has also been found to help protect the cartilage by increasing the production of collagen and other substances that maintain its integrity.

 

10. Dandelion - Dandelion contains several bioactive compounds, such as flavonoids and polyphenols, that possess anti-inflammatory properties. These compounds may help reduce inflammation in the body, which is associated with conditions like arthritis, joint pain, and chronic diseases.

 

11. Other supplements with anti-inflammatory properties - Rutin has anti-inflammatory properties, which can help reduce inflammation in the body. Chronic inflammation is linked to various health conditions, including arthritis, cardiovascular disease, and cancer. Rutin may help alleviate symptoms and reduce the risk of these inflammatory diseases. Other products that may benefit with anti-inflammatroy properties include echinacea, rosehips, milk thistle, copper, nattokinasedark chocolate, chamomile tea, spirulina, chaga mushrooms, reishi mushrooms, ashwagandha, astaxathin, vitamin E, melatonin, garlic, quercetin, zinc, vitamin C, and beets.

 

While natural supplements can offer potential benefits, consulting with a healthcare professional before incorporating them into your routine is crucial. They can provide guidance based on your specific needs, help assess potential interactions with medications, and ensure appropriate dosing.
